Bouncing-Ball-Animation

  • A c++ project simulating collision between balls in 2D and 3D.
  • Built using openGL, glut and glui libraries.
  • Glui implements a very simple and sover GUI which allow users to control different attributes of the balls.

Features

  • User can play/pause the scene, change number of balls, change color of balls, increase/drcrease speed of balls.

  • User can select a particular ball by clicking on it and then change its corresponding attributes.

  • If no ball is selected then attributes of all the balls will change.

  • Supports four "Look & Feel" options - Default, Metallic, High Contrast, Pool/Billiard

  • 2D and 3D mode.

Instructions

For compiling use make command. Once the program is running, following holds,

  1. Space Bar will toggle Play/Pause.
  2. In 3D mode, dragging the mouse will change orientation of the cuboid and scrolling will zoom in/out.
  3. In 3D mode, user can move the cuboid by arrow keys.
  4. Enter and Esc key will quit the program.
